Summary | "A chance encounter is about to change everything for Thea Wynter. The moment she arrived on the Isle of Skye, life changed for Thea. Running from a succession of wrong turns, she comes to the island in search of blue sea, endless skies, and mountains that make the heart soar. Here, she feels at peace. As head gardener at Rothach Hall, life is exactly how she wants it, with her days spent working in the glorious clifftop garden and her evenings in the cosy local village. But an encounter with a stranger from the mainland brings with it an unexpected turn - and only time will tell if he is friend or foe. It seems that even on Skye, life can catch up with you, and Thea is soon faced with the past she left behind - and with it, the family she's never met ... "--Back cover. |
